Mrs. Theresa “Tee” Joyce Williams was born on November 26, 1956 to the late Lee Williams and Betty Jean Yearby in Columbus, GA.

She was united in Holy Matrimony to the Late James Ellis Williams Jr. for 40 years and to this union 3 beautiful children were born. She received her education from Pinevale School, in Valdosta, GA.

At an early age Theresa received Christ.

Theresa was employed with the Wild Adventures Company in Valdosta, GA for many years. Theresa was a loving, devoted and passionate wife, mother, grandmother, great-grandmother, big sister, aunt, and friend. Theresa lived her life with an open heart and open door policy to her family and friends. She was a joy to be around and was loved by all.
